53 <br /> <br />A RESOLUTION APPOINTING VIEWERS FOR CLOSING A PORTION <br />TEN FOOT ALLEY ON THE WEST SIDE OF EVERGREEN PLACE. <br /> <br />OF A <br /> <br /> WHEREAS, James H. Coppage has made application to <br />vacate, close and discontinue the hereiaafter-described <br />portion of a ten foot alley, and it appearing that Notice of <br />Application and Request for Appointment of Viewers has been <br />advertised as required by law. <br /> <br /> N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Council of the <br />City of Portsmouth, Virginia, that Richard D. Ottavlo, James <br />P. Ely, Clinnon J. Fortune, Matthew J. Peanort, and L. A. <br />Clark, be appcinted viewers and that Raymond Tweed and Simon <br />P. Arrington, be appointed alternate viewers in the evenn one <br />of the preceding viewers fails to participate, said viewers <br />to view the hereinafter-described portion of such street and <br />to report to this Council in writing whether in their oDinion <br />any, and if any what, inconvenience would result in vacating <br />and closing the following: <br /> <br />Ten Foot Alley <br /> <br /> Ali. that portion of the ten (10) foot alley <br />situate in the City of Portsmouth, Virginia, <br />running through Block Ten (10) on the plat of <br />Piedmont Heights, recorded in the Clerk's Office <br />of the Circuit Court of the City et Chesapeake <br />in Map Book 4, page 52, described as follows: <br />Beginning on the west side of Evergreen Place <br />at the southeast corner of Lot Thirteen (13) in <br />Block Ten (10) on said plat of Piedmont Heights; <br />thence west 110 feet; thence south 75 feet; thence <br />east 10 feet; thence north 65 feet; thence east <br />100 feet to the west side of Evergreen Place <br />and thence north along Evergreen Place 10 feet <br />to the point of beginning. <br /> <br /> Said property is shown on Tax Map 139, and <br /> is bounded by Parcels 26, 27, and 48 on said <br /> map. <br /> <br /> Adopted by the Council of the City of Portsmouth, <br />Virginia, at a meeting held August 9, 1988. <br /> <br />Teste: <br /> <br />City Clerk <br /> <br /> <br />
